PHP内置数据库解决方案:SQLite的应用与最佳实践311
PHP 作为一门强大的服务器端脚本语言,广泛应用于 Web 开发。虽然 PHP 通常与 MySQL、PostgreSQL 等关系型数据库配合使用,但它也具备内置数据库支持,那就是 SQLite。对于一些小型应用、原型开发或需要快速部署的项目而言,使用 SQLite 作为数据库可以大大简化开发流程,提高效率。本文将深入探讨如何利用 PHP 内置 SQLite 功能,并提供一些最佳实践。
SQLite 的优势:
选择 SQLite 作为 PHP 应用的数据库,主要基于以下几个优势:
轻量级:SQLite 是一个无服务器的数据库,无需独立的数据库服务器进程,直接以文件的形式存在。这使得部署和维护都更加简单,也减少了系统资源的占用。
易于使用:SQLite 的 API 简单易懂,PHP 提供了内置的函数来方便地操作 SQLite 数据库,无需安装额外的数据库驱动程序。
跨平台:SQLite 支持多种操作系统,包括 Windows、Linux、macOS 等,保证了应用的移植性。
安全性:虽然 SQLite 本身没有复杂的权限管理系统,但通过文件权限控制可以有效地保障数据库的安全。
事务支持:SQLite 支持事务处理,保证数据的完整性和一致性。
PHP 操作 SQLite 的基本方法:
PHP 提供了 `sqlite_open()`、`sqlite_query()`、`sqlite_fetch_array()` 等函数来操作 SQLite 数据库。以下是一个简单的例子,演示如何创建数据库、创建表以及插入数据:```php
2025-05-31

PHP高效处理JSON数据:接收、解析与应用
https://www.shuihudhg.cn/115288.html

Python高效下载中国气象数据共享服务平台(CIMISS)数据
https://www.shuihudhg.cn/115287.html

Python高效实现Excel数据匹配:多种方法及性能比较
https://www.shuihudhg.cn/115286.html

PHP对象获取:方法详解及最佳实践
https://www.shuihudhg.cn/115285.html

Python爬虫实战:高效数据采集与处理
https://www.shuihudhg.cn/115284.html
热门文章

在 PHP 中有效获取关键词
https://www.shuihudhg.cn/19217.html

PHP 对象转换成数组的全面指南
https://www.shuihudhg.cn/75.html

PHP如何获取图片后缀
https://www.shuihudhg.cn/3070.html

将 PHP 字符串转换为整数
https://www.shuihudhg.cn/2852.html

PHP 连接数据库字符串:轻松建立数据库连接
https://www.shuihudhg.cn/1267.html